NEW BUSINESS: CONSIDER NOTIFICATION OF F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E AWARD FOR CORE SERVICES FUNDS AND AUTHORIZE CHAIR TO SIGN-INNERCHOICE COUNSELING CENTER:Judy Griego, Director of Social Services, stated the Innerchoice Counseling Center will provide Intensive and Step-Down Services for Residential Treatment Center placements, for the term beginning January 1, 2002, and ending May 31, 2002. Commissioner Vaad moved to approve said award and authorize the Chair to sign. Seconded by Commissioner Long, the motion carried unanimously. CONSIDER NOTIFICATION OF F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E AWARD FOR CORE SERVICES FUNDS AND AUTHORIZE CHAIR TO SIGN- SAVIO HOUSE: Ms. Griego stated Savio House will provide alternative programs to Residential Treatment Center placements as discussed in the previous item. Commissioner Long moved to approve said award and authorize the Chair to sign. Seconded by Commissioner Vaad, the motion carried unanimously. 2001-3342 BC0016 CONSIDER NOTIFICATION OF F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E AWARD FOR CORE SERVICES FUNDS AND AUTHORIZE CHAIR TO SIGN-STILLWATER SERVICES CENTER: Ms. Griego stated Stillwater Services Center will provide Alternative Programs to Residential Treatment Center placements, for the term beginning January 1, 2002, and ending May 31, 2002. She stated the funding will be from the Child Welfare Block Grant. In response to Commissioner Vaad, Ms. Griego stated she will work with the 19th Judicial District to encourage them to consider these programs as alternatives, and after a meeting with Judge Klein and Magistrate Tuttle, she has agreed to do monthly reporting to the 19th Judicial District on the impact the programs are having on the RTC numbers. Commissioner Long commented the Department is being cautious not to do too much too fast, and they will continue to communicate as to which programs are working. Commissioner Vaad moved to approve said award and authorize the Chair to sign. Commissioner Long seconded the motion, which carried unanimously.
